This book provides a historical sketch of the Seneca County Medical Society, including information on its pioneer members and those who are currently active. It covers various aspects of medical practice in Seneca County, such as the development of medical education, the role of physicians in the community, and the challenges faced by medical practitioners. This book is an essential read for anyone interested in the history of medicine in Seneca County.
